The Graduate Certificate in Non-Profit Marketing Strategy is a specialized program designed to equip students with the skills and knowledge required to develop effective marketing strategies for non-profit organizations.
This program focuses on teaching students how to create and implement marketing plans that align with the mission and goals of non-profit organizations, with an emphasis on strategic marketing, brand management, and fundraising.
Upon completion of the program, students will be able to demonstrate their understanding of non-profit marketing principles and practices, including market research, target audience analysis, and campaign evaluation.
The Graduate Certificate in Non-Profit Marketing Strategy typically takes one year to complete and consists of four courses, which can be taken full-time or part-time.
The program is designed to be flexible and can be completed online or on-campus, making it accessible to working professionals and individuals with busy schedules.
